Swimming pool toys make a great addition to your pool and are great to have on hand at all times. There are many types of swimming pool toys you can buy and here are some ideas on what is available:

1) Inflatable mattresses. These are good for just lounging, relaxing or reading a book while in the pool

2) Inflatable inner tubes. Great for people who are not strong swimmers but want to get around even in deeper water.

3) Foam noodles. Also great for people who are not great swimmers and are also great for your in-pool workout routine!

4) Balls, nets, rackets, etc. These can be used for a variety of water games and are especially fun to use when there is a large crowd of people who want something to do as a group.

5) Inflatable boats. These are good for just floating around without getting wet.

There are also many ultimate pool toys on the market today that are a combination of the above toys or just a bigger or better version of them. Any of these can be purchased at stores that sell pool supplies, most department stores and toy stores. You can even make your own toys at home with various items found around the house but make sure to take into consideration the safety of those who will be using them and never allow children to use any toy without proper supervision!
